ANC moves media briefing on Zuma’s exit

The African National Congress (ANC) has postponed its media briefing on President Jacob Zuma’s removal from 12 o’ clock noon until to 2 o’clock this afternoon.

The party says the reason is to inform its structures of the NEC’s decision, and to send the president a formal letter of recall.

The briefing follows the marathon meeting held by the party’s National Executive committee in Irene outside Pretoria last night, where the NEC decided to call for a motion of no confidence in the president if he refuses to accept his recall.

Party president Cyril Ramaphosa and Secretary General Ace Magashule were sent to Zuma’s official residence to ask him to step down.
